Considering how expensive party tickets are, we would not spend party time at a table service restaurant. If you want a TS meal, your party tickets will allow you to enter the MK starting at 4:00 so I would look for a reservation around 4:30 or 5:00 instead. Or you could have a late TS lunch at one of the nearby resorts (e.g. Kona, Grand Floridian Cafe, Whispering Canyon Cafe) and head to the MK around 4:00 and either have a quick service dinner before the party or just snack during the party itself.
